jewel beetle
nounDefinitions
Any of the very many beetles of the family Buprestidae, known for their glossy,…
Any of the very many beetles of the family Buprestidae, known for their glossy, iridescent colours.
- This effect can be produced not only by purposeful ringbarking with an axe but also by insects, such as longicorns and jewel beetles, feeding in the phloem-cambium under the bark.
- The ceiling and the chandelier of the main hall were covered with the wing cases of thousands of Asian jewel beetles.
